Using CoImage with Microsoft's NetMeeting

Requirements:

1. Microsoft Windows 95 (tm)
2. Internet Explorer version 3.0
3. Net Meeting
4. A pkzipped version of the Single User CoImage Installation

Instructions:

1. Install Internet Explorer 3.0 and NetMeeting on a machine running Windows 95 operating system
2. Install single user CoImage application in the metip directory. Both users mush have this setup
3. Run NetMeeting. Start a conference with someone.
4. Run single user CoImage application.
5. Under the Tools Menu, share the CoImage Application.
6. Under the Tools Menu, start collaborating by using turn taking.
7. Run a warper activity by selecting the Warper menu item under the Activites menu, or by pressing the Warper button (top row, third from left).
8. Open a file to warp by using the File Open... menu item or the Open button (top row, fifth from the left)
9. Select a Draw Source or Draw Destination button (bottom row, first or third from left) to draw the lines. use the Move Source or Move Destination tools to modify lines that have already been drawn (bottom row, second and fourth from the left).
